REC OUT mode
•When using the audio/video recording connectors (MEDIA PLAYER
outputs), you can record the audio or video from a different program
source while listening to the currently played track.
•For the connection method, see “Connecting a media player”
(vpage22).
1
Press ZONE/REC SELECT until “RECOUT Source”
is displayed.
2
Press ZONE/REC SELECT to choose the input source
to be recorded.

3
Start recording.
•For operating instructions, refer to the respective device’s
operating instructions.
•To cancel, press ZONE/REC SELECT until
“ZONE2 Source” is displayed.
•Make a test recording before starting the
actual recording.
•Sources selected with the REC OUT mode
are output from ZONE2 as well.

NOTE
•Recordings you make are for your personal enjoyment and should
not be used for other purposes without permission of the copyright
holder.
•Input sources for which “Hide” is selected at “Hide Sources”
(vpage137) cannot be selected.
•To record video signals through this unit, use the video cable for
connection between this unit and the player.
•Make an analog connection for audio signals.
